In the Middle Ages last names told of the place where a person was from. Example is Leonardo da Vinci . This means Leonardo of Vinci. In England often the names of jobs became part of the name or the "son of" . In Germany a name like Wasserman translates to water man. The use of last names only developed in the last 500 years.
